Prabhaas Kshetra This
area is a holy area. It is near Dwaarakaa, on the coast of Gujaraat. It
is related to Krishn's life's events. Padm Puraan (p 271) says that it is
present Sauraashtra. Legend has it that the
Kaalbhairav Shiv Ling (Bhairavanaath) at Prabhaas was worshipped by
Chandramaa, and hence Shiv here is referred to as Som Naath. The Skand
Puraan describes the Sparsh Ling of Som Naath as one bright as the sun,
the size of an egg, lodged underground. The Mahaabhaarat also refers to
the Prabhaas Kshetra and the legend of Chandramaa worshipping Shiv. |
